Section Env-Ws 342.10 - Treatment Techniques
(a) The department shall require community water systems and non-transient, non-community water systems to install and use any treatment method identified in Env-Ws 345 through Env-Ws 347 as a condition for granting a variance except as provided in (b), below. If after the installation of the treatment method the system still cannot meet the MCL, the system shall be eligible for a variance.
(b) If a system can demonstrate, through comprehensive engineering assessments which may include pilot plant studies, that the treatment methods identified in Env-Ws 345 through Env-Ws 347 would only achieve a de minimis reduction in contaminants, the department shall issue a schedule of compliance that requires the system being granted the variance to examine other treatment methods as a condition of obtaining the variance.
(c) If the department determines that a treatment method identified in (b), above, is technically feasible, the department shall require the system to install and use that treatment method in connection with a compliance schedule issued. The department's determination shall be based upon studies by the system and other relevant information.
(d) The department shall require a public water system to use bottled water or point-of-use devices or other means as a condition for granting a variance from the requirements of Env-Ws 345 through Env-Ws 347 to avoid an unreasonable risk to health.
